Tungsten Carbide Cutting tools, drills, abrasives Non-technical pch scratch games onlineIt has an ultimate tensile strength of 344 MPa, an ultimate compression strength of about 2.7 GPa and a Poisson's ratio of 0.31. The speed of a longitudinal wave (the speed of sound) through a thin rod of tungsten carbide is 6220 m/s. Tungsten … See more Tungsten carbide is prepared by reaction of tungsten metal and carbon at 1,400–2,000 °C. Other methods include a lower temperature fluid bed process that reacts either tungsten metal or blue WO 3 with CO/CO2 mixture and H 2 between 900 and 1,200 °C.
